Turkish Airlines Flight Diverted to Barcelona Due to Bomb Hoax

Incident Overview

MADRID, Jan 15 (Reuters) - A false bomb threat delivered via an onboard mobile connection caused a Turkish Airlines flight from Istanbul to make an emergency landing at Barcelona's El Prat Airport on Thursday, Spanish police and the airline said.

Details of the Bomb Threat

A Turkish Airlines spokesperson said earlier that the plane had landed after crew detected that a passenger had created an in-flight internet hotspot which was named to include a bomb threat as the aircraft approached Barcelona.

Police Investigation

Spain's Guardia Civil police force said in a statement that following a thorough inspection of the aircraft after its passengers had disembarked, the alert had been deactivated and no explosives had been found. Spanish airport operator AENA said El Prat was operating normally.

Previous Hoax Incidents

Police have launched an investigation to determine who was behind the hoax, the statement added.

Turkey's flag carrier has faced previous incidents of hoax threats, usually made via written messages, that led to emergency landings over the years.

(Reporting by David Latona and Jesus Calero in Madrid and Ceyda Caglayan in Istanbul, editing by Andrei Khalip and Susan Fenton)
